7th Battalion Royal Tank Regiment, on being called upon to send Churchills to Korea, selected 'C' Squadron so to do. Personnel sailed from Southampton on transport Empire Fowey arriving at Pusan on 12.10.50 where they awaited arrival of their tanks.

By all accounts the Churchills performed well without loss except for a Mark VII and an a ARV self- destroyed during the evacuation from Seoul. The remains of the former can be seen in the photograph below.

As during WW II, tank names all began with the letter 'G'
'C' Squadron: Garry  George  Glynis  Gynaelator etcetera.
